Abeona Therapeutics Joins Russell Indexes for Enhanced Growth

Abeona Therapeutics' Significant Achievement in Index Membership
Abeona Therapeutics Inc. (Nasdaq: ABEO) has recently reached a significant milestone by being admitted to the U.S. small-cap Russell 2000 Index and the broad-market Russell 3000 Index. This momentous event was part of the Russell stock indexes' annual reconstitution, which took effect immediately with the opening of the U.S. equity markets.

The Importance of Russell Indexes
Russell indexes are recognized as essential benchmarks for investment managers and institutional investors. With approximately $10.6 trillion in assets tied to Russell's U.S. indexes, Abeona's membership not only elevates its visibility but also enhances its credibility within the investment community. As a result, the company is now better positioned to attract interest from potential investors who monitor these indexes for decision-making in equity investments.
Details About Russell Indexes
Being part of the Russell 3000 Index not only signifies membership in large-cap indices, like the Russell 1000 Index, or small-cap ones like the Russell 2000 Index, but it also entails inclusion in specialized growth and value style indexes. The Russell 3000 index includes the 3,000 largest publicly traded companies listed in the U.S., ranked by market capitalization, thus providing a broad benchmark for investment strategies.

About Abeona Therapeutics
Abeona Therapeutics Inc. specializes in developing transformative therapies utilizing cell and gene technology. The company operates a state-of-the-art Good Manufacturing Practice (cGMP) facility in Cleveland, Ohio, which is vital for producing ZEVASKYN for commercial use. In addition to ZEVASKYN™, Abeona is advancing a pipeline of adeno-associated virus (AAV)-based therapies targeting key ophthalmic diseases, addressing substantial unmet medical needs. Their innovative approaches include developing next-generation AAV capsids aimed at enhancing treatment effectiveness for various serious conditions.
